Huge lot with 2 shops! This 1950's home features huge living room, kitchen & large master bedroom with bath. 20x40 shop with a loft in the back & a separate 14x30 shop for RV or toys, both shops have cement floors. Lots of room for garden & lots of potential. Huge fenced yard has mature fruit trees & grapes. Convenient, circular driveway as well as a 2 car garage. This home could be just what you have been waiting for!

R-1
Low-Density Residential Zone
The purpose of the R-1 Low-Density Residential zone is to implement the comprehensive plan by providing areas for low-density residential use. The R-1 zone is designed for single-unit dwellings with some allowance for other types of dwellings and middle housing and is also intended to provide a limited range of non-residential uses that can enhance the quality of low-density residential areas.
